Job Description

My client is a luxury menswear and womenswear designer known for their exquisite fabrics, classic design and heritage. It is a fantastic opportunity to work for a very well respected, highly desirable brand in one of the most prestigious department stores with a high performing team.

Main responsibilities will include:

  • Supports the Department Manager in order to guarantee an excellent level of service is maintained at all times.
  • Supports the Department Manager in the optimization of the overall sales performance. Being a reference point for the team in the sales process, increasing the customer service standards and working for the continuous development of the team's product knowledge and selling skills
  • Supports the Department Manager in order to give all the necessary information to Area Managers
  • Maintains excellent customer relationships and ensures high levels of customer satisfaction
  • Actively participates in managing all the critical situations related to the sales process and/or to the customers, so issues are solved in the best possible way
  • Supports the Department Manager in order to make the store team cohesive and coordinates its activities in order to constantly have a motivated, positive and well performing team.
  • Continuously supports the Department Manager in the team management
  • Ensures the observance of all the internal procedures
  • Supports the Department Manager ensuring that the shop windows and the displays are always in good conditions and strictly comply with the company guidelines
  • Knowledgeable of all the Company procedures for the store and oversees their proper execution
  • Carries out training activities for the team in order to avoid stealing
  • Supervises the stockroom, ensuring that stick is in line with the sales potential, communicating with the related team
  • Supports the Department Manager in managing all the activities related to the annual closure, category flash inventories and fiscal annual inventory

Person Requirements

  • Experience working within luxury menswear, womenswear or accessories
  • Experienced working with large team and turnover
  • Very strong managerial background with experience dealing with HR procedures
  • Aligned with the brand identity, detail oriented, with strong training, communication and leadership skills.
  • Passion and high motivation for the luxury environment
  • Deep knowledge of the clothing and luxury market
  • Computer literate; SAP Retail experience preferred
  • Fluent English, both spoken and written; other languages are a plus
